Description:
APPROACH--12 miles from the 7,200 foot Southeast Fork of the Kahiltna Glacier landing strip via the Northeast Fork of the Kahiltna Glacier to the 12,500 foot bergschrund; travel and camp with attention to numerous hanging glaciers in the Northeast Fork.
TOTAL TIME--20 to 24 days
VERTICAL GAIN--7,800 feet
DIFFICULTIES & DANGERS--Extremely difficult mixed climbing (5.9,A3), with short sections of vertical ice.
CAMPS--The lowwer rock face offers only hanging bivouacs and occasional ledges; level camps at 16,000 and 17,800 feet.
